應用程式

邊緣計算與雲端運算

使用案例:何時選擇邊緣或雲端運算

探索無伺服器JavaScript和流行框架的世界。 瞭解無伺服器技術如何增強JavaScript開發,以實現可擴展,高效的應用程式。

內容

相關頁面

歡迎來到我們的學習中心,我們將在這裏討論邊緣計算和雲端運算。 深入瞭解這些計算方法的主要差異,使用案例和優勢,幫助您做出明智的決策,哪些更適合。

無伺服器JavaScript和框架:徹底革新應用程式開發

在現代計算領域,有兩種模式脫穎而出: 邊緣計算 和雲端運算。 兩者都有其獨特的優勢,適合不同的使用案例。

什麼是雲端運算?

雲端運算是指提供計算服務,包括伺服器,存儲,數據庫,網路,軟體, 分析和智能—通過網際網路(“雲”)提供更快的創新,靈活的資源和規模經濟。 它以其存儲和處理大量數據的能力,可擴展性以及處理資源密集型任務的效率而聞名。 瞭解有關雲端運算的更多資訊。

什麼是邊緣計算?

另一方面,邊緣計算是一個分佈式計算框架,它使企業應用程式更接近物聯網設備或本地邊緣伺服器等數據源。 這種與源數據的接近性可顯著縮短響應時間並節省帶寬。 邊緣計算正在成爲許多物聯網部署中的關鍵組件。 瞭解有關邊緣計算的更多資訊。

邊緣和雲端運算之間的主要差異

  1. 數據處理位置:雲端運算處理遠程伺服器上的數據,通常在數據中心。 邊緣計算處理本地設備上或更靠近數據源的數據。

  2. 延遲:邊緣計算可提供較低的延遲,因爲它靠近數據源,使其成爲實時應用的理想選擇。 相比之下,雲端運算可能會因數據傳輸距離較遠而導致延遲更高。

  3. 帶寬使用:邊緣計算可減少必須傳輸到雲的數據量,從而降低帶寬使用率和成本。 雲端運算雖然效率高,但通常需要更多帶寬才能在遠程伺服器之間傳輸數據。

  4. 可擴展性:雲端運算提供了顯著的可擴展性,使企業能夠輕鬆擴展其計算資源。 邊緣計算不太注重可擴展性,而更多的是減少延遲和帶寬使用。

  5. 使用案例:邊緣計算通常用於物聯網設備,自動駕駛車輛和智能城市應用。 雲端運算用於大數據分析,電子郵件服務以及需要大量計算能力的各種其他應用程式。

邊緣和雲端運算的集成

在許多情況下,最有效的方法是利用邊緣和雲端運算的混合方法。 Edge可以在本地處理即時計算和數據處理,而雲可用於長期數據存儲和更多資源密集型任務。 這種方法在無伺服器架構和物聯網應用中特別有效

安全注意事項

兩者都面臨着獨特的安全挑戰。 邊緣計算需要保護許多設備和本地節點,而雲端運算必須確保雲中的數據傳輸和存儲安全。 在這兩種情況下,瞭解Web應用程式的安全性 至關重要。

邊緣計算和雲端運算在IT生態系統中具有不同但互補的作用。 邊緣計算在速度和降低延遲至關重要的情況下表現出色,而雲端運算爲複雜的處理任務提供了無與倫比的可擴展性和強大功能。 

如需瞭解更多見解和 最佳實踐,請瀏覽我們的學習中心。

相關頁面

有問題?

如需瞭解有關如何使用微服務優化您的應用和安全性的任何疑問或進一步資訊,請 聯繫我們的專家。 我們的團隊致力於爲您提供所需的見解和支援,幫助您應對複雜的Web應用程式生命週期開發。

趨勢主題

最新網路安全威脅2023